#set -e

srcdir="${srcdir:-.}"
CERTTOOL="${CERTTOOL:-../../src/certtool${EXEEXT}}"
DIFF="${DIFF:-diff -b -B}"
if ! test -z "${VALGRIND}"; then
	VALGRIND="${LIBTOOL:-libtool} --mode=execute ${VALGRIND}"
fi

#check whether "funny" spaces can be interpreted
${VALGRIND} "${CERTTOOL}" --certificate-info --infile "${srcdir}/funny-spacing.pem" >/dev/null 2>&1
rc=$?

# We're done.
if test "${rc}" != "0"; then
	echo "Funny-spacing cert decoding failed 1"
	exit ${rc}
fi

#check whether a BMPString attribute can be properly decoded
${VALGRIND} "${CERTTOOL}" --certificate-info --infile "${srcdir}/bmpstring.pem" >tmp-pem.pem
rc=$?

if test "${rc}" != "0"; then
	echo "BMPString cert decoding failed 1"
	exit ${rc}
fi

#FIXME: the output string differs in windows and linux on the last char.
${DIFF} "${srcdir}/bmpstring.pem" tmp-pem.pem || ${DIFF} --strip-trailing-cr "${srcdir}/bmpstring.pem" tmp-pem.pem
rc=$?

if test "${rc}" != "0"; then
	echo "BMPString cert decoding failed 2"
	exit ${rc}
fi

#check whether complex-cert is decoded as expected
${VALGRIND} "${CERTTOOL}" --certificate-info --infile "${srcdir}/complex-cert.pem" >tmp-pem.pem
rc=$?

if test "${rc}" != "0"; then
	echo "Complex cert decoding failed 1"
	exit ${rc}
fi

cat "${srcdir}/complex-cert.pem" |grep -v "Not After:" >tmp1
cat tmp-pem.pem |grep -v "Not After:" >tmp2
${DIFF} tmp1 tmp2 || ${DIFF} --strip-trailing-cr tmp1 tmp2
rc=$?

if test "${rc}" != "0"; then
	echo "Complex cert decoding failed 2"
	exit ${rc}
fi

#check whether the cert with many othernames is decoded as expected
${VALGRIND} "${CERTTOOL}" --certificate-info --infile "${srcdir}/xmpp-othername.pem" >tmp-pem.pem
rc=$?

if test "${rc}" != "0"; then
	echo "XMPP cert decoding failed 1"
	exit ${rc}
fi

cat "${srcdir}/xmpp-othername.pem" |grep -v "Not After:" >tmp1
cat tmp-pem.pem |grep -v "Not After:" >tmp2
${DIFF} tmp1 tmp2 || ${DIFF} --strip-trailing-cr tmp1 tmp2
rc=$?

if test "${rc}" != "0"; then
	echo "XMPP cert decoding failed 2"
	exit ${rc}
fi

rm -f tmp-pem.pem tmp1 tmp2

exit 0
